About Ambarvale 2560

The size of Ambarvale is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. There are 19 parks, covering nearly 20.8% of the total area. The population of Ambarvale in 2016 was 7374 people. By 2021 the population was 7254 showing a population decline of 1.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ambarvale is 0-9 years. Households in Ambarvale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ambarvale work in a machinery operators and drivers occupation.In 2021, 54.00% of the homes in Ambarvale were owner-occupied compared with 54.00% in 2016.

Ambarvale has 2,560 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Ambarvale have seen a 36.52%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 67.08%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Ambarvale is $966,550 while the median value for Units is $631,974.
  • Houses have a median rent of $600 while Units have a median rent of $470.
